How Long Does It Take to Push Mow an Acre – Ultimate Direction to Calculate

How long does it take to push mow an acre? It is a frequently asked question nowadays.

Generally, the time is dependent on the type of landscape, size of the mower, length of the lawn, push mower’s moving speeds, and more. But, the average working time is one to three hours an acre. To get the work done check the best zero-turns under 5000.

The Condition of the Lawn

The first and foremost considering matter is the lawn conditions. If the yard contains various obstacles such as hills, fences, trees, or curves, you can’t mow it within a short duration.

On the other hand, anyone would like to cut grass quickly when the yard is square with no barriers.

So, it is nearly impossible to count how many obstacles can slow your cutting time. Remember that yard obstacles have to kill your valuable time.

Length of Your Lawn

Length or size is a vital issue when you want to measure the cutting time. If your lawn is larger, you might invest extra mowing time for enough results. No one can avoid this.

Alternatively, shorter lawns require limited mowing time. So, before starting work, you discover how large the lawn is. Then, you can know how long it takes to cut lawns.

Size of Your Push Mower Deck

Another considering thing is your push mower’s deck size. The mower deck indicates how long it takes. When you can use a larger deck to mow the grass, it allows you to cut the larger lawns.

Average Lawn Mower Times and Speeds

The average speed of the push lawn mowers is three MPH which is suitable for mowing the garden properly. Alternatively, the average time is sure of the sizes of the push mow an acre.

If the push mower is twenty-one inches, it qualifies for perhaps two hours to cut an acre of the lawn. With the twenty-two-inch push mower, it puts up with about one hour thirty-nine minutes to now per acre.

Moreover, a thirty-inch push mower takes perhaps one hour and thirteen minutes.

See at a glance.

The size of a push mower

The average time the Per Acre

21-inch push mower2 hours
22-inch push mower1 hour 39 minutes
30-inch push mower1 hour 13 minutes

Besides the twenty-two-inch push mower’s average lawn mowing pace is .6 acre per hour. And, you find a .75 per hour rate from the thirty-inch push mower size.

Can You Mow an Acre with a Push Mower?

With a thirty-inch push mower, it takes around three hours at 80% efficiency. Also, it takes overall forty-five minutes with the forty-eight-inch mowers at 80% efficiency.

When you are choosing sixty-inch or seventy-two-inch decks, you can’t finish your task in under thirty minutes to an acre.
